The Environmental Impact of Sports
The sports industry, encompassing everything from local recreational activities to global mega-events like the Olympics and the FIFA World Cup, has a significant environmental footprint. The construction of sports facilities, transportation of athletes and fans, and the energy consumption associated with these events contribute to greenhouse gas emissions and other environmental issues.
